On Cybertron, Autobots were like human civilians. Decepticons were the military.

They weren't all cars either. In the movie, there's Percepter that turns into a microscope/telescope thing. Skyhigh was a helicopter, Cloudburst was a jet, and there was a couple more that transformed together into one big bot.
Some weren't Earth vehicles either, the one's that hover were Cybertronian vehicles.
